Fresh off the heels of Colleen Ballinger’s unfortunate ukulele apology for grooming children, youtuber Danny “YungSpaghetti” Samuels has now released a mumble rap apology video in response to video surfacing of him driving his car into the storefront of a Victoria’s Secret.

Many fans of his are criticizing him for the apology because they, “Can’t understand what he’s saying” and when they turn the video captions on, the only thing they say is “Spaghetti Samuels Spittin Silly on the Beat”.

YungSpaghetti was asked about why he made the rap so particularly mumbly, especially when trying to deny such serious allegations. YungSpaghetti had this to say: “I wanted my apology to be left up to interpretation. What did I do? Why am I apologizing? What am I saying? That’s for SpaghettiNation to decide.” We asked YungSpaghetti to clarify if he actually committed the crime and, if so, why? He simply stated, “The boobies in the window got me, dawg”.

Samuels has been dropped by his biggest sponsor, Ragu. He has, however, created a new line of energy drinks called “Spaghetti Sawce”, which taste similar to a combination of Clamato and human blood. One 16 oz can of Spaghetti Sawce has 400mg of caffeine, which is roughly equivalent to five cups of coffee or one and a half lines of cocaine. The drink will only be sold next to gas station diet pills, as well as in college dining halls across the nation.
